Understanding Personal Property Insurance for Homeowners and Renters in Calgary

Whether you’re a homeowner or a renter, personal property insurance provides a safety net for your possessions in case of unforeseen events. As an insurance agent in Calgary, understanding the intricacies of personal property insurance can help you better serve your clients and ensure they have the protection they need.

Personal property insurance is a component of homeowners or renters insurance policies. It covers the loss or damage of personal belongings due to various risks such as theft, fire, vandalism, and natural disasters. This type of insurance ensures that your valuables, including furniture, electronics, clothing, and other personal items, are financially protected.

Why Homeowners Need Personal Property Insurance
For homeowners, personal property insurance is a vital part of their overall home insurance policy. While the structural coverage protects the physical building, personal property insurance covers the contents inside the home. In Calgary, where the weather can be unpredictable, having comprehensive coverage is crucial. This insurance helps homeowners recover financially if their belongings are damaged or destroyed.

The Importance for Renters
Renters often overlook the importance of personal property insurance, assuming their landlord’s insurance will cover their belongings. However, a landlord’s insurance typically covers the building structure, not the tenant’s personal items. Renters in Calgary should consider personal property insurance to protect their possessions from potential risks. This coverage can provide peace of mind knowing that their belongings are safeguarded.

Coverage Details
An insurance agent in Calgary can help clients understand the specifics of their personal property insurance policy. Typically, these policies cover:

1. Replacement Cost or Actual Cash Value. Policies can either pay the replacement cost of an item or its actual cash value, which factors in depreciation. Clients should understand the difference and choose the option that best suits their needs.

2. Coverage Limits. Policies have limits on the amount that can be claimed for certain items. High-value items like jewelry or electronics may require additional coverage.

3. Off-Premises Coverage. Personal property insurance often extends coverage to belongings that are not on the insured property, such as items in a car or luggage during travel.

Making a Claim
In the unfortunate event that a homeowner or renter needs to make a claim, the process typically involves the following steps:

1. Documentation. The policyholder should document the damage or loss with photographs and detailed descriptions.

2. Inventory. Having an up-to-date inventory of personal belongings can simplify the claims process.

3. Contacting the Insurance Agent. The policyholder should immediately contact their insurance agent in Calgary to report the claim and receive guidance on the next steps.
